All Projects → ilgilenio → Otag

ilgilenio / Otag

Licence: mit
Otağ JavaScript Çatısı GitHub Yansısı

Programming Languages

javascript
184084 projects - #8 most used programming language

Projects that are alternatives of or similar to Otag

ejscript
Embedthis Ejscript
Stars: ✭ 58 (+100%)
Mutual labels:  javascript-framework
Webster
a reliable high-level web crawling & scraping framework for Node.js.
Stars: ✭ 364 (+1155.17%)
Mutual labels:  javascript-framework
Liquidcore
Node.js virtual machine for Android and iOS
Stars: ✭ 765 (+2537.93%)
Mutual labels:  javascript-framework
haas-mini-program
HaaS轻应用框架
Stars: ✭ 26 (-10.34%)
Mutual labels:  javascript-framework
Tui
This is a high quanlity components library for VUE
Stars: ✭ 258 (+789.66%)
Mutual labels:  javascript-framework
Ember.js
Ember.js - A JavaScript framework for creating ambitious web applications
Stars: ✭ 22,092 (+76079.31%)
Mutual labels:  javascript-framework
nanobox-express
Quickstart for Express on Nanobox
Stars: ✭ 13 (-55.17%)
Mutual labels:  javascript-framework
10 Weeks
10-weeks of technology exploration
Stars: ✭ 22 (-24.14%)
Mutual labels:  javascript-framework
React Scope
Visualize your React components as you interact with your application.
Stars: ✭ 316 (+989.66%)
Mutual labels:  javascript-framework
Reef
A lightweight library for creating reactive, state-based components and UI.
Stars: ✭ 700 (+2313.79%)
Mutual labels:  javascript-framework
foxx-builder
ArangoDB Foxx Services in a super intuitive way
Stars: ✭ 22 (-24.14%)
Mutual labels:  javascript-framework
A-Tour-of-JavaScript
This Repository consist of Daily learning JS, Assignments, coding challenge, projects, references, tutorial
Stars: ✭ 22 (-24.14%)
Mutual labels:  javascript-framework
Library Detector For Chrome
🔍 Extension that detects which JavaScript libraries are running on a page
Stars: ✭ 566 (+1851.72%)
Mutual labels:  javascript-framework
virtual-dom
Application framework for real time collaboration using Croquet
Stars: ✭ 14 (-51.72%)
Mutual labels:  javascript-framework
Must Watch Javascript
A useful list of must-watch talks about JavaScript
Stars: ✭ 6,545 (+22468.97%)
Mutual labels:  javascript-framework
purescript-pop
😃 A functional reactive programming (FRP) demo created with PureScript events and behaviors.
Stars: ✭ 33 (+13.79%)
Mutual labels:  javascript-framework
Troika
A JavaScript framework for interactive 3D and 2D visualizations
Stars: ✭ 342 (+1079.31%)
Mutual labels:  javascript-framework
Mojiito
DEPRECATED - No longer maintained! Mojito is a JavaScript framework, heavily inspired by Angular, which brings the benefits of components, services, ... to your (static) website.
Stars: ✭ 13 (-55.17%)
Mutual labels:  javascript-framework
Nest Cli
CLI tool for Nest applications 🍹
Stars: ✭ 889 (+2965.52%)
Mutual labels:  javascript-framework
Website
Source for emberjs.com
Stars: ✭ 621 (+2041.38%)
Mutual labels:  javascript-framework
Otağ Logo

Otağ Çatı Çalışması

ES6 NodeJS npm downloads

Süreğen bir JavaScript çatısı olan Otağ, öncelikle ön uç şablonlamadaki yalınlık sorununu çözer.

Kodlarınızı yalınlaştırırırken, sunucu yükü ve harcamalarınızı azaltır.

Soyutlamalar, özel yapılar, kolay Model/View Tanımı ve veri birleştirmeleriyle, büyük ölçekli tasarılarınızda kod bütünlüğünüzü korur.

İlkeler

Otağ Çatı çalışması temel ilkeleri şunlardır:

  • Yalınlık
  • JavaScript uzantı tabanlı olduğu için yöntemleri olabildiğince uzantı olarak yazmak
  • İstemciyi etkin kullanarak sunucu yükünü azaltırken.
  • Yiv ölçünleri(Kod kalitesi)ne özen göstermek
  • Bellek yönetimine özen göstermek
  • Zengin bileşenleri tek biçimlilik ile yalınlaştırmak
  • Tamga yazımını kullanmak

Sürüm

Sürümleri ve etkinlikleri izleyin 📆

2.1 otag.js otag.min.js (16.4KB, 6kb GZIP)

Araçlar

import {araç} from 'otag'

biçiminde kullanabileceğiniz araçlar

  • Disk (ES6 Proxy) Yerel Yığınak soyutlayıcısı (localStorage abstractor)
  • Page Betler arası yönlendirme işletmeni
  • Time Yalın zaman kütüphanesi
  • Tor Tor istekçisi (Network requester)
  • Chain Ardışıl işlevlerden Süreç derleyicisi

Belgelendirme

Türkçe İngilizce GitHub Wiki GitLab Wiki

Yeterge

MIT Yetergesi ile dağıtılmaktadır.


Yardım

GitLab üzerinde sorun bildirebilirsiniz. Bunun yanında Telegram takımımıza yazabilirsiniz.

Katılım sağlama

♥ Tasarının geliştirilmesi için bunları göz önünde bulundurularak katkı sağlayabilirsiniz.

İletişim

İşbirlikleri ve daha fazlası için [email protected] bulunağına ileti gönderebilirsiniz.

Otağ, Tengri Dağı
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].